How to Figure Out What Tattoo I Want
Deciding on a tattoo can be an overwhelming task, especially if you’re new to the world of body art. With countless designs, symbols, and meanings to choose from, it’s easy to feel lost. However, with a bit of research and self-reflection, you can figure out what tattoo you want that resonates with your personality and life experiences. Here are some tips to help you in your quest to find the perfect tattoo design.
1. Reflect on Your Motivations
Before diving into the world of tattoo designs, take some time to think about why you want a tattoo. Is it to commemorate a significant event, honor a loved one, or express your personal beliefs? Understanding your motivations will help you narrow down the type of tattoo that will best represent your story.
2. Research Different Styles
Once you have a clear idea of what your tattoo represents, it’s time to explore different tattoo styles. Research various designs, such as traditional, tribal, watercolor, or geometric tattoos, and see which ones catch your eye. Remember, the style of your tattoo should complement your skin tone and body type.
3. Consider the Placement
The placement of your tattoo is just as important as the design itself. Think about where you want your tattoo to be, as this will affect its visibility and maintenance. Common placement areas include the arms, back, chest, and legs. However, some people prefer less noticeable spots like the wrist or ankle.
4. Create a List of Ideas
Make a list of potential tattoo ideas that you find appealing. This list can include words, symbols, or images that hold personal significance to you. Don’t worry about the order or the specifics at this point; the goal is to gather all the ideas that come to mind.
5. Narrow Down Your Choices
Go through your list of ideas and eliminate any that don’t resonate with you. Consider the meanings behind each design and how they align with your personal values. This process will help you narrow down your options and focus on the tattoos that truly speak to you.
6. Consult with a Tattoo Artist
Once you have a shortlist of tattoo ideas, it’s time to consult with a professional tattoo artist. They can provide valuable insights and help you refine your design. Be open to their suggestions and don’t hesitate to ask questions about the process and aftercare.
7. Trust Your Instincts
In the end, it’s essential to trust your instincts when choosing a tattoo. If a particular design or idea feels right, go with it. Remember that your tattoo is a permanent piece of art that represents you, so it’s crucial to be confident in your choice.
By following these steps, you’ll be well on your way to figuring out what tattoo you want. Take your time, do your research, and choose a design that you’ll be proud to wear for a lifetime.
